About Sariba

Sariba AS is a Norwegian-owned consultancy that lives by making everyday life easier and better for employees, managers and those who work within HR. We do this by delivering products, services and consulting within HR-Strategy, HR-Processes and HR-Technology.
We have been doing this since we started in 2000, and we can proudly say that we have over two decades of doing just that. We specialize in SAP HXM and SAP SuccessFactors and have one of Norway's most competent environments in these fields. In fact, we are so good at SAP that we have been named SAP Partner of the year, 2 years in a row! With us, competence is always on the agenda, and if you become our new colleague, you will experience that competence sharing is something we value very highly.

Since we started, we have grown in size, locations and type of projects we take on. The Sariba family consists of 50 dedicated, professionally skilled and committed colleagues based in Norway, Sweden and Spain, and if you become our new colleague, you will have the pleasure of working with both Norwegian and international customers.
